The Opportunity
We are seeking a proactive and detail-oriented Purchasing Officer to join our planning team. In this role, you will be responsible for ensuring the timely availability of raw materials to support production, while optimising inventory levels, supplier performance, and procurement outcomes.
This is a key role within the supply chain function, working closely with suppliers and internal stakeholders to ensure materials are planned, ordered, and delivered efficiently to meet customer demand and production requirements.
- Manage the procurement and availability of raw materials to support production schedules and ensure finished goods are delivered on time and in full
- Use supply planning systems and MRP tools to maintain optimal inventory levels and improve procurement accuracy
- Monitor and manage supplier performance, identifying supply risks, constraints, and opportunities for improvement
- Develop and execute purchasing and replenishment plans aligned to business forecasts and operational requirements
- Optimise stock holdings to balance service levels, working capital, and business objectives
- Identify and communicate supply issues, implementing and supporting mitigation actions where required
- Collaborate with suppliers and internal stakeholders to support new product introductions and phase-out activities

What You’ll Bring
- Experience in purchasing or supply chain within an FMCG or manufacturing environment
- Tertiary qualifications in supply chain, manufacturing, business, or a related field
- Experience working with ERP systems (e.g. MFG Pro/QAD, Microsoft Dynamics 365 or similar)
- Strong analytical skills with advanced Excel capability and exposure to reporting/BI tools
- Understanding of food manufacturing environments, including HACCP, GMP, and food safety standards
- Strong communication skills with the ability to influence suppliers and internal stakeholders
